today's guest is Louisa Onome. she's a Nigerian-Canadian writer of books for teens and adults & a video game narrative designer with Sweet Baby Inc.
in this episode we dive into...
- louisa’s childhood loves of contemporary writing starting with fanfiction, playing video games (notably Final Fantasy!!), Tatterhood, & Clockwork
- playing the long-game with her soul calling of being a writer
- how she spent five years writing several manuscripts & having them be rejected by agents yet persisting with ease because she knew her dreams manifesting were inevitable
- using her craft to explore, reflect, shed, & evolve into her authentic self and how she creates from what she knows now
- taking a break from projects when they’re not feeling aligned anymore
- other people’s art inspiring her to own her ‘weirdness’ as a person and artist
- transitioning from a chaotic quantitatively-driven creative practice into a more organized and intentional one that still honors the magick of the unknown
- the importance of loving what you’re creating and self-validation above all else
- working in solitude as an author versus the collaborative nature of game writing
- discovering there are different ways to be an adult that can honour her inner child
